Altera DE2控制面板压缩包的探索与应用

版权申诉
0 下载量 118 浏览量 更新于2024-11-03 收藏 743KB ZIP 举报
资源摘要信息:"DE2控制面板是由Altera Corporation开发的,是基于Altera FPGA的DE2开发板的重要组件。DE2开发板是一种用于教学和研究的高级数字电子实验平台,它提供了丰富资源,包括微处理器、内存、各种输入输出设备等,可以用于实现各种数字逻辑和嵌入式系统设计。DE2控制面板作为其界面控制部分,通常包含有用于调整和监控开发板上各种硬件资源状态的按钮、开关、指示灯等,其功能类似于电脑上的BIOS系统,为用户提供了与硬件底层交互的接口。" 知识点一:DE2控制面板的功能与结构 DE2控制面板是Altera公司为DE2开发板设计的硬件配置工具,其主要功能是让使用者能够更加方便地管理和控制开发板上各类硬件资源。通过控制面板,用户可以加载不同的配置文件,设置开关状态,以及监控LED和七段显示器等输出设备的状态。此外,DE2控制面板通常还整合了简单的诊断功能,帮助用户检测硬件状态,便于进行故障排除。 知识点二:DE2开发板和FPGA DE2开发板是基于FPGA(现场可编程门阵列)技术构建的,FPGA是一种可以通过编程来配置其逻辑功能的集成电路。与传统的微控制器或ASIC(应用特定集成电路)相比,FPGA具有更高的灵活性和可重配置性,适合于进行快速原型设计和系统验证。在DE2开发板上,FPGA是核心组件,可以用来实现复杂的数字逻辑设计,包括处理器核心、各种接口控制器、图像处理单元等。 知识点三:Altera Corporation和其产品 Altera Corporation(后被Intel Corporation收购)是一家全球领先的可编程逻辑设备制造商,其产品广泛应用于通信、工业、消费电子等领域。除了DE2开发板和相关的控制面板之外,Altera还生产多种型号的FPGA,包括小型低成本Cyclone系列、中档Arria系列以及高性能的Stratix系列。Altera提供的开发环境Quartus Prime支持对其所有FPGA产品的编程与调试,大大简化了设计流程。 知识点四:FPGA开发环境和工具链 FPGA的开发流程一般包括设计输入、综合、布局与布线、时序分析以及下载配置等步骤。在Altera的FPGA开发中,使用Quartus Prime作为主要的综合工具,它可以将设计者用硬件描述语言(如VHDL或Verilog)编写的逻辑设计转化为FPGA的配置文件。除了Quartus Prime,开发人员还需使用其它辅助工具,例如ModelSim进行仿真,SignalTap进行逻辑分析,以及NIOS II软核处理器等。 知识点五:数字系统设计 DE2控制面板和DE2开发板作为数字系统设计的重要工具和平台,为教学和研究提供了实现数字电路设计、验证和测试的环境。数字系统设计通常包括数字逻辑设计、微处理器系统设计、系统集成、时序分析和测试验证等方面,是一个高度综合性的工程实践。通过使用这些平台,学生和工程师可以学习和掌握数字系统设计的基本原理和方法,进行各种复杂的电子系统设计和创新。 知识点六:硬件描述语言 硬件描述语言(HDL),如VHDL和Verilog,是设计数字电路的专用编程语言,能够描述电路的行为、结构和层次信息。在使用FPGA进行设计时,HDL是表达设计意图的主要方式之一,设计者利用这些语言编写代码,描述电路的逻辑功能和接口行为。最终这些代码会被综合工具转换成FPGA内部的逻辑门和触发器配置信息,从而实现预定的电路功能。熟练掌握HDL是进行FPGA设计的基础要求。